Flashing Lights on Control Panel

Last night, I went to start my dishwasher. I pressed the Start button before noticing that I was on "Pots and Pans" instead of "Normal". I immediately pressed the "Cancel" button in order to change the cycle. I heard the drain cycle start and finish, then I saw the "Normal" button flashing. I could not select any other cycle, and got no reaction when pressing "Start". I pressed the "Cancel" button again, but it just started flashing as well as the "Normal" button. At this point, I flipped the circuit breaker off, counted to 10, and flipped it back on. This made the "Cancel" button stop flashing, but the "Normal" button kept flashing. I then checked the interior to make sure that the overfill cover moved freely, that the sprayers could all turn freely, and that the filters were clear. No change. I tried the reset procedures found elsewhere in this forum (alternately pressing "Heated Dry" and "Normal"; pressing any three buttons in sequence three times; and pressing and holding various buttons for three seconds each) with no success. The trouble shooting guide from Whirlpool does not address anything associated with flashing lights. I've left the door open and unlatched for 12 hours now with no change. Any suggestions that don't involve calling a repairman?

What everyone fails to tell you in these answers is....1. You can't reset it if the lights are on. Each time you hit the normal and heated dry, and it doesn't work, you're sending a signal to the control board to make another selection. Wait until all the lights are off, with the door open, press the "Normal" button, then "Heated Dry, and then do it again. Shut the door and all the lights will come on at once. It's reset then. Don't try and reset it with the "Pots and Pans" light on, just leave the door open and wait for the lights to go off. This means the control board has finished running through all the buttons that were pushed and it's waiting for a new signal.

meadbrewer try to reset your dishwasher. To reset it, you will have to have the door open. It can not be latched. Press "Heated Dry," "Normal," "Heated Dry," "Normal" within three seconds of the first pressed button. Now close the door, this should reset your dishwasher. Hope this helps, good luck

Turn off the power. Open the dishwasher, take out the top 6 screws. The top control panel should pull away from the dishwasher. Pop off the plastic cover inside to expose the circuit board. Disconnect the 14 or 16 pin ribbon cable. Turn the power on. With the power on, carefully reconnect the ribbon cable. Reassemble your dishwasher. This worked for me!

I also tried all of the previous reset solutions, circuit breaker trick, door opened/door closed and nothing really worked. I found another solution on another forum from a dishwasher repairman who said it is likely the touch control panel that needs to be replaced. My dishwasher is almost 15 years old so I replaced the touch control panel and that fixed my problem. It can also be the control board that the control panel plugs into as well. If you’ve tried all of the other solutions, and made sure your dishwasher is not in-between cycles, try replacing your touch panel, then the control board. It’s more like the touch panel as that gets a lot of wear and tear. The control board is 100% solid state so it’s less likely to be the problem, unless you get frequent power surges in your electrical lines. But that would do more damage than a blinking Normal light - just say’n ….

You're right there are no electronics in the touch control. It is a bubble control in that when you push a "button" you are closing the gap between the front of the panel to touch the back of the panel which closed the circuit and sends a signal to the main board. That is why the control panel is usually the problem. The "bubble" collapse which makes the front touch the back which then sends a confusing signal to the main board. Hope this helped.

Just wanted to add the cause of our problem on our Whirlpool QP3 in case it can help another consumer. After dismantling our dishwasher door and control panel, I found and eradicated several German cockroaches. I assume these roaches were sheltering in the control panel for warmth and they were also relieving themselves on the main PCB. Our house is located in the woods in GA and, despite regular pest treatments and a clean home, roaches in GA are just a reality.

I killed the roaches in the panel, removed the dishwasher completely from the kitchen counter, and sprayed insecticide both around the machine and inside the dishwasher door that, once dry, continues to provide protection against pests. Once I cleaned all of the fecal matter off the PCB, let it dry THOROUGHLY, and reassembled the machine in place, the dishwasher is functioning flawlessly once again. Just in case others could be experiencing the same problem, I wanted to add our fix.
